Roles and Permissions
ご覧のページは、お客様の利便性のために一部機械翻訳されています。また、ドキュメントは頻繁に更新が加えられており、翻訳は未完成の部分が含まれることをご了承ください。最新情報は都度公開されておりますため、必ず英語版をご参照ください。翻訳に問題がある場合は、 こちら までご連絡ください。

ロールの作成と管理

ロールと権限を 理解 したら、ロールを作成し、ユーザーが Liferay DXP ソリューション内で作業できるようにすることができます。

コントロール パネル → ユーザー → ロールでロールを作成および管理します。

ロールの作成

まず、 作成する必要があるロールのスコープ を決定します。 ロールの範囲は、グローバル (通常のロール)、サイト、組織、アセット ライブラリ、またはアカウント別に設定できます。

  1. グローバル メニュー (Global Menu) を開き、 コントロール パネル タブに移動して、 役割をクリックします。

  2. 追加 (Add) をクリックします。

  3. 役割の種類を選択します。

  4. ローカライズ可能なタイトルと説明を入力します。

  5. キーを入力してください。 これは、プログラムでロールを参照するための一意の識別子です。 デフォルトでは、タイトルの値が使用されます。

  6. [保存]をクリックします。

ロールの種類を選択し、タイトル、説明、キーを入力します。

これで、 ロール権限を定義 し、 ユーザーにロールを割り当てることができます。

ロールの更新

ロールのタイトル、説明、キーはいつでも更新できますが、タイプ/スコープを変更することはできません。

これを行うには、ロールの アクション (Actions) をクリックし、 編集を選択します。 完了したら、 「保存」をクリックします。

ロール管理権限

個々のロールを管理するための権限を割り当てることができます。

  1. ロールの アクション ボタン (Actions) をクリックし、 権限を選択します。

  2. 既存の通常ロールが選択したロールに対して実行できるアクションを指定します。 この割り当ては個々のロールごとに行われ、ロール アプリケーションの権限を定義する とは異なります。

    ロールの作成と管理のための権限を設定できます。

デフォルトでは、所有者と管理者の通常ロールのみがロールに対してこれらの権限を付与できます。 管理者ロールは権限を変更できないため、権限マトリックスには表示されません。 テスト インストールのデフォルト ユーザーにはこの権限がグローバル スコープで付与されており、すべてのアクションを実行できるほか、ユーザーを割り当てたり、ロールの権限を定義したりすることもできます。

警告

これらの権限の付与には注意してください。 これは、少数の信頼できるユーザーに任せるのが最適な管理機能です。

ロールの削除

  1. ロールの アクション (Actions) をクリックし、 削除を選択します。

  2. 本当にロールを削除してもよいか確認してください。 ロールは、それに関連付けられているすべての ワークフロー タスク割り当て とともに直ちに削除されます。

    ロールを削除するには、[OK] をクリックします。

役割の重複

ライフレイ DXP 2025年第3四半期

既存のロールとその現在の権限を複製できます。 これは、複数のロールが多くのアプリケーションにわたって同様のアクセスを共有する大規模な環境で役立ちます。 ロールを複製するには、

  1. ロール リストで、複製するロールの横にある アクション (Actions) をクリックし、 複製 (Duplicate icon) を選択します。

  2. 複製されたロールの新しい名前を入力します。 名前は一意である必要があり、元の名前と一致することはできません。

  3. [保存]をクリックします。

Liferay は、元のロールと同じ権限を持つ新しいロールを作成します。 作成後、ロールの詳細ページにリダイレクトされ、そこでロールの構成を確認および変更できます。

現在の権限のみがコピーされます。 後で新しいアプリケーションがデプロイされた場合、その権限は複製されたロールに追加されません。

ロールのエクスポートとインポート

必要に応じて、ロールをエクスポートおよびインポートできます。 ただし、Liferay は会社全体および個人のサイト権限のみをエクスポートします。 サイトおよびアセット ライブラリ関連のアクセス許可はエクスポートされません。

エクスポートまたはインポートのプロセスを開始するには、

  1. ロール アプリケーションを開き、アプリケーション バーの オプション (Options Button) をクリックし、 エクスポート/インポートを選択します。

    ロール アプリケーションを開き、アプリケーション バーの [オプション] をクリックして、[エクスポート/インポート] を選択します。

  2. エクスポート/インポート プロセスを構成したり、LAR ファイルをダウンロードおよびアップロードしたり、現在のエクスポート/インポート プロセスと以前のエクスポート/インポート プロセスを確認したりします。

    エクスポート/インポート プロセスを構成および確認します。

アセットコンテナを削除するとアセットが削除される

Web コンテンツ フォルダーには、Web コンテンツの記事が含まれています。 Web コンテンツ フォルダーはアセット コンテナーであり、Web コンテンツの記事はアセットです。 個々のアセットを削除する権限をロールに付与せずに、アセット コンテナーを削除する権限をロールに付与することは可能です。 その場合、ロールの割り当て先が個々のアセットを含むアセット コンテナーを削除すると、個々のアセット自体も削除されるので注意してください。

アセットコンテナアセット
WebコンテンツフォルダーWebコンテンツ
ナレッジベースフォルダナレッジベースの記事
掲示板のカテゴリ掲示板スレッド
WikiノードWikiページ
ドキュメントとメディアフォルダドキュメント
フォームフォームレコード
動的データリスト動的データリスト・レコード
アプリビルダーオブジェクトアプリビルダーアプリ

アセット コンテナーの例としては、Web コンテンツ フォルダーのほか、ブックマーク フォルダー、メッセージ ボード カテゴリ、Wiki ノード、ドキュメント フォルダー、メディア フォルダーなどがあります。